The phrase "and does not involve any complex" is grammatically correct and can be used in written English.
It can be used when describing a process, task, or situation that is straightforward and does not require intricate or complicated elements.
Example: "This method is efficient and does not involve any complex calculations, making it accessible for beginners."
Alternatives: "and does not require any complicated" or "and does not entail any intricate".
